Eid ul Fitr 2026 will be celebrated across Pakistan on Saturday, March 21, 2026. The decision was made after the Central Ruet e Hilal Committee confirmed that the Shawwal moon was not sighted anywhere in the country on Thursday.
Most Eid prayers in Karachi will take place shortly after sunrise. The majority of them are scheduled between 6:45 AM and 7:45 AM.
However, some mosques will hold later prayers up to 10:00 AM to manage larger crowds.

In many large mosques and open grounds, more than one Eid namaz will be held to accommodate the number of worshippers.
Authorities have also advised the people that they reach their nearest mosque early to avoid congestion and rush.
Security and traffic arrangements will also be in place around major prayer venues.

Eid ul Fitr announced for Friday in parts of KP
Eid ul Fitr has been announced in Mardan for Friday with at least 17 testimonies of moon sighting on Thursday.
Earlier, some parts of Bajaur also announced that they will be celebrating Eid ul Fitr on Friday.
Despite the official announcement by the Central Ruet e Hilal Committee that the moon had not been sighted, various areas of Khyber Pukhtunkhwa (KP) have announced to celebrate the Eid on Friday.
